On this day April 12 1983, Time Line was released, marking the eleventh studio album by Renaissance.

The record represented a shift in the band’s style, incorporating more contemporary rock and pop influences compared to their earlier symphonic prog sound. While it divided some longtime fans, Time Line showcased the group’s attempt to adapt to the changing musical landscape of the 80s.

80s insight: Time Line reflected how many progressive rock bands of the 70s adjusted their sound in the 80s, embracing modern production and pop elements to stay relevant.
